The #1 Way To Keep Apples From Turning Brown

A simple method ensures cut apple slices remain fresh and appealing for packed lunches and snacks by preventing browning.

Instructions

  1. Prepare a salt solution by dissolving 1 teaspoon of salt in 1 cup of water; ensure sufficient volume to fully submerge apple slices.

  2. Peel (optional), core, and slice the apple to your desired thickness.

  3. Soak the apple slices in the salt water for 10 minutes.

  4. Drain, rinse the apple slices under cool running water, then pat them dry.

  5. Serve the apple slices immediately or store them in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 12 hours.
